    <summary><![CDATA[FX has nabbed itself an Oscar-nominated acting legend for its high-profile Guillermo del Toro pilot, "The Strain."Joining a previously announced cast that includes Corey Stoll, Kevin Durand and Mia Maestro, John Hurt will portray Professor Abraham Setrakian in the pilot, based on the best-selling vampire novel trilogy by del Toro and Chuck Hogan. The professor is described as a holocaust survivor who immigrated to the U.S. after World War II and now runs a pawn shop in Spanish Harlem. As a mysterious viral outbreak with hallmarks of an ancient and evil strain of vampirism spreads, he may be the only one with answers -- if anyone will listen.Stoll stars as Dr. Ephraim Goodweather, the head of the Center for Disease Control Canary Team in NYC.     <summary><![CDATA[The telethon for the Muscular Dystrophy Association, occurring yearly since 1966, is making the jump from syndication to primetime on ABC, the organization announced on Monday (June 17). The network will air the two-hour "MDA Show of Strength Telethon" on ABC stations countrywide on Sept. 1 from 9-11 p.m., running an hour shorter than last year's telecast.The telethon has raised millions of dollars each year towards research and aid for people with muscle diseases since its debut in 1966. The move to ABC marks the first time in its 48-year history that it will appear on a single network, providing greater visibility and marketing potential for the event."We're delighted to partner with ABC," MDA president and CEO Steven M.
